CCD Photometry, Light Curve Modeling and Period Analysis of the Overcontact Eclipsing Binary BN Ari
Alton, K. B.; Nelson, R. H.; Boyd, D. R. S.
United States, Canada, United Kingdom
Abstract
We present photometric and spectroscopic data of BN Ari, a totally eclipsing variable star. 15 new times-of-minimum have been determined. These along with other published eclipse timings were used to update the linear ephemeris and evaluate changes in orbital periodicity. Radial velocity data along with a definitive classification spectrum are reported for the first time. Simultaneous modeling of multicolor light curves and radial velocity data was accomplished using the Wilson-Devinney code with optimization by differential corrections. The weight of evidence from evaluating both the eclipse timing differences and light curve modeling indicates that BN Ari is most likely a triple system.
